Men's soccer picks up 2-2 tie against Indiana

October 23, 2011

The MSU men’s soccer team tied Indiana 2-2 Sunday in Bloomington, Ind.

The Spartans (4-7-4 overall, 1-2-2 Big Ten) fell behind early when the Hoosiers (9-3-2, 3-1-0) scored twice in the 31st and 49th minutes.

MSU evened up the score with a goal from senior defender Stephen Lucianek in the 54th minute, followed by a goal from freshman forward Adam Montague just four minutes later.

Montague leads the Spartans in goals with four on the season.

Indiana outshot MSU 27-6, with senior goalkeeper Jeremy Clark making seven saves.
